Acthaside: a new chromone derivative from Acacia ataxacantha and its biological activities

2016 
Background Acacia ataxacantha (Fabaceae), used in traditional medicine grows in the South-West of Benin. Ethyl acetate extract of the barks of this species was previously reported to display various bioactivities, including antibacterial, antifungal and antioxidant activities. In the present study, we investigate the antimicrobial and antioxidant activities of compound isolated from ethyl acetate extract of Acacia ataxacantha.
